Job description

At Capgemini Engineering, the world leader in engineering services, we bring together a global team of engineers, scientists, and architects to help the world’s most innovative companies unleash their potential. From autonomous cars to life‑saving robots, our digital and software technology experts think outside the box as they provide unique R&D and engineering services across all industries. Join us for a career full of opportunities. Where you can make a difference. Where no two days are the same.

Your role

As an Engagement Manager, you will lead a blended team of engineering SMEs and consultants to deliver against client requirements and identify solutions to their business problems. This will involve managing bid activities, and mobilising and delivering projects that will lead to the convergence of physical and digital worlds through technology, engineering and manufacturing expertise.

Your responsibilities will include:

  • Project delivery and management
  • Bid management
  • Project planning, quality and controls
  • Contract and scope management
  • Financial monitoring and reporting
  • Revenue and margin management and improvement
  • Tracking and reporting progress to time, cost and quality
  • Quality control
  • Continuous process improvement
  • Problem resolution
  • Resource allocation
  • Client satisfaction
Your profile
  • Extensive experience in delivering engineering, manufacturing, and/or business or technological change and transformation projects.
  • Demonstrable experience of consultancy or collaboration with clients.
  • Minimum 5 years' experience working in project, programme or bid management, with at least 2 years leading complex, multi‑functional teams to time, cost and quality objectives.
  • Ability to work with clients to derive solutions from uncertain requirements.
  • Proficiency with project finances, revenue recognition, margin improvement, risk management and upward reporting.
  • Proven ability to plan and organise projects effectively, with excellent attention to detail.
  • A developed understanding of business and finance, project planning and scheduling, budgeting and cost management, revenue recognition and contract management.
  • Must be a Sole UK National and able to obtain MOD SC clearance.
  • Degree qualified or equivalent in an engineering or management discipline, or experience working in complex engineering/manufacturing/digital transformation environments.
  • Experience of delivering complex projects across Aerospace & Defence sectors.
  • Experience with Siemens engineering toolsets.
  • Experience working in a consultancy organisation.

Capgemini is a global business and technology transformation partner, helping organizations to accelerate their dual transition to a digital and sustainable world, while creating tangible impact for enterprises and society. It is a responsible and diverse group of 340,000 team members in more than 50 countries. With its strong over 55-year heritage, Capgemini is trusted by its clients to unlock the value of technology to address the entire breadth of their business needs. It delivers end-to-end services and solutions leveraging strengths from strategy and design to engineering, all fueled by its market leading capabilities in AI, generative AI, cloud and data, combined with its deep industry expertise and partner ecosystem.
